Deck & Commander Strategies

  • Gishath, Sun's Avatar

    Gishath, Sun's Avatar

    Ramp aggressively to cast Gishath and trigger its combat damage ability to reveal and put multiple dinosaurs onto the battlefield, overwhelming opponents with big creatures.

  • Nashi, Moon's Legacy

    Nashi, Moon's Legacy

    Attack to exile and copy legendary or rat cards from the graveyard, generating value and board presence by reusing powerful cards.

  • Wort, Boggart Auntie

    Wort, Boggart Auntie

    Goblin tribal deck that recurs goblins from the graveyard each upkeep, enabling continuous pressure through swarm tactics and cheap creatures.

  • Zedruu the Greathearted

    Zedruu the Greathearted

    Political control deck that donates permanents to opponents, gaining life and card draw based on opponents' permanents while disrupting their plans.

Gameplay Summary

The game begins with players establishing their mana bases and early board presence, setting the stage for their diverse strategies.

Gishath, Sun's Avatar aims to ramp quickly to cast massive dinosaurs, leveraging his companion Kaheera to maintain a purely dinosaur-themed deck.

Nashi, Moon's Legacy focuses on attacking to exile and copy powerful legendary or rat cards from the graveyard, utilizing a graveyard recursion and value-copying strategy.

Wort, Boggart Auntie builds a tribal goblin swarm, repeatedly returning goblin cards from the graveyard to maintain pressure and board presence.

Zedruu the Greathearted operates a political and control-oriented strategy that involves donating permanents to opponents, gaining life and drawing cards based on the number of permanents opponents control.

Early plays include land drops and mana fixing, with some players engaging in minor disruption like Vandalblast to remove key artifacts, but the game remains mostly slow-paced as players develop their resources and board states.
